How does Meta recruiting work?

Meta recruiting involves a multi-stage process including online application submission, assessments, interviews, and background checks. Candidates are evaluated based on skills, experience, and cultural fit, often through virtual or in-person interviews, with the goal of matching talent to available roles within the company.

Is it hard to get hired by Meta?

Getting hired by Meta can be competitive due to high application volume and rigorous interview processes. Candidates typically need strong technical skills, relevant experience, and a good understanding of the company's culture and values. Preparation for multiple interview rounds, including technical assessments and behavioral interviews, is essential.

What is Meta Recruiting?

Meta Recruiting refers to the recruitment team and processes at Meta, formerly known as Facebook, that are responsible for attracting, evaluating, and hiring top talent across various departments such as engineering, product, design, and operations. Meta recruiters work closely with hiring managers to understand role requirements, source candidates, conduct interviews, and guide applicants through the hiring process. They also play a key role in employer branding, diversity initiatives, and ensuring a positive candidate experience throughout the process.

How much does a Meta recruiter make?

Meta recruiters typically earn an average base salary ranging from $70,000 to $130,000 annually, depending on experience, location, and level within the company. Compensation may also include bonuses, stock options, and benefits, with senior roles earning higher total packages. Recruiters at Meta often use applicant tracking systems and require strong interpersonal skills.

How does a recruiter at Meta typically collaborate with hiring managers and cross-functional teams during the recruitment process?

At Meta, recruiters work closely with hiring managers to understand the specific needs of each open role, helping to craft job descriptions and define candidate profiles. They collaborate with cross-functional teams such as Human Resources, Diversity & Inclusion, and sometimes technical teams to ensure an inclusive and efficient hiring process. Regular syncs and feedback sessions are common, allowing recruiters to stay aligned with evolving business needs and provide candidates with timely updates. This collaborative approach helps streamline decision-making and ensures a high-quality candidate experience.
